Perhaps the best part of the episode, though, was the way it didn’t flinch at the conflict between Bow (Tracee Ellis Ross) and Dre (Anthony Anderson) over how - or even whether to - explain the unfolding news story to their pre-teen twins. Meanwhile, Yara Shahidi - as eldest daughter Zoey - was especially raw as a young woman feeling utterly hopeless about how she could effect change personally and politically. As Dre’s parents, Laurence Fishburne and Jenifer Lewis managed to convey the deep history of suspicion with which many black folks view law enforcement, while also managing to score the episode’s biggest laughs. The half hour occasionally strained in its efforts to make statistics and harsh truths a natural part of the dialogue, a situation common to many series’ “Very Special Episodes.” (That said, maybe we should all go to our local book store and get Ta-Nehisi Coates’ Between the World and Me… just sayin’.)īut ultimately, the multi-generational approach to the subject matter proved as illuminating as it was moving.
